Product Support Engineer – Treatment Delivery Imaging
We are looking for a candidate with a strong support mindset to help our customers, Varian Field Service Engineers and Installations Engineers operating Varian products.
You will be a part the Product Support Engineering (PSE) Imaging team responsible for third level support of imaging components on Varian’s linear accelerators. The PSE Imaging team are highly skilled engineers conducting technical investigations, supporting the Field Service representatives, authoring service documentation and providing input & feedback to the R&D organization.
Specific Responsibilities
Conduct technical root cause analysis related to the Varian Medical Systems Imaging products by diagnosing, troubleshooting, and debugging complex systems
Respond to situations where first level and second level field service support was not able to isolate or fix problems in malfunctioning equipment or software
Author technical documentation for the Field Service and Installationorganizations
Support new product rollouts and initiate knowledge transfer to the Installation- and Field Service teams
Report design, reliability and maintenance discrepancies to the Engineering teams
Represent the Global Customer Service organization and provide input to the Engineering teams during new product introductions
